## Quillbase Environments

The Quillbase team is refactoring the legacy ORM layer in stages, so plugin authors should expect entity mappings to differ between staging and production until the Marlowe migration completes. Plugins must not cache schema metadata across requests during this window. The current environment settings for the staging cluster are listed below.

deployment values, fahap-hahaf:
[casdor]
port = 9200
region = south-2
host = casdor.qirvanworks.corp
timeout_ms = 3000
retries = 4

Subject: Cut-over complete — Lanternfold GraphQL N+1 fix

Hello plugin authors,

Last night we completed the cut-over to the batched resolver layer in the Lanternfold API. The N+1 pattern that caused slow responses on nested collection fields has been eliminated; list queries now resolve in a single batched pass. Plugins that relied on per-item resolver hooks should switch to the batch callback interface before the next release. No schema changes were made. The gateway now runs with the following settings.

settings of fawip-yadug:
[druath]
port = 3000
region = north-4
host = druath.qirvanworks.corp
timeout_ms = 1500
retries = 1

Ticket: SiteSprout incremental rebuilds are failing with connection resets. Support team: when customers report stale pages, the rebuild worker likely lost its link to the content index mid-run. Re-queue the build; partial output is discarded automatically. If failures persist past two retries, escalate. To check index health yourself, connect using the connection string below.

database URL for tajog-bajeg: mysql://soreth_svc:OzsCjhu@db-6997.nelvrostack.internal:5432/kelax

## Session Handling

The ChronoGate chip reader maintains a session for each connected plugin, rotating it every twelve hours or after 10,000 read events, whichever comes first. Plugin authors must re-handshake when the reader emits a SESSION_EXPIRED frame; failing to do so silently drops subsequent split times. Always store session state in volatile memory only, never on the reader's SD card. For sandbox testing against the Fenwick Relay staging reader, authenticate using the following bearer token.

login token, hahif-bajog: eyJhbGciOiJIUzI1NiIsInR5cCI6IkpXVCJ9.eyJzdWIiOiIHJXUrbIn0.JC-NFEAJ